Validation Evidence For 0.3.0

Meridian Workflow

The application-controlled meridian workflow was physically exercised on June 10, 2026. The adapter notified the application near +2 degrees, allowed the simulated active frame to complete, changed pier side, reacquired the target, resumed tracking, and returned through HOME to PARK.

Focuser

The shared-bus focuser smoke test passed on June 10, 2026:

  • mount remained PARKED at every checkpoint;
  • a 100-step move completed;
  • the focuser returned exactly to its starting position;
  • a longer move was interrupted with :FQ#;
  • final exact return succeeded;
  • mount communication remained operational.

Mechanical Safety Authority

The counterweight warning approach passed on June 13, 2026:

  • PARK to HOME established trusted HOME authority;
  • a target before the warning boundary remained allowed;
  • pier side, hour angle, counterweight state, margin, warning, and refusal state were reported;
  • final HOME to PARK succeeded.

Stock OnStep Firmware Fallback

The staged Axis-1 proof passed on June 13, 2026:

  • operator-confirmed checkpoints: 60, 120, 150, 170, 178.5 degrees;
  • tracking was off and verified at each checkpoint;
  • natural tracking was armed at Axis-1 178.514 degrees;
  • OnStep autonomously stopped at Axis-1 180.00013 degrees;
  • two stationary non-tracking polls confirmed the firmware stop;
  • the independent raw-stop backstop at 180.25 degrees was not needed;
  • endpoint and complete path were physically confirmed safe;
  • final HOME to PARK succeeded.

Independent RA And DEC Motion

The 0.3.0 motion APIs were physically exercised on June 14, 2026.

The bounded correction smoke test:

  • routed PARK to HOME and acquired a safe target;
  • executed center-rate RA east/west and DEC north/south corrections;
  • executed guide-rate RA east and DEC north pulses;
  • sent the matching directional stop after every correction;
  • preserved tracking throughout;
  • returned through HOME to live PARK.

The larger coordinate-path test then proved visually observable independent coordinate movement:

initial:       RA=12.528611h DEC=20deg
RA increase:   RA=13.528611h DEC=20deg
DEC increase:  RA=13.528611h DEC=30deg
RA decrease:   RA=12.528611h DEC=30deg
DEC decrease:  RA=12.528611h DEC=20deg

Every leg stabilized at the requested target within tolerance. The final target matched the initial target, and operator confirmation authorized the final HOME-to-PARK route. The command ended with:

PASS: independent RA/DEC coordinate path completed and final state PARKED.

Before movement, both commands verified Raspberry/OnStep civil time, observer location, and sidereal time while PARKED.

Interpretation

The stock Axis-1 fallback is much later than the normal operational stop. It is accepted only as final crash prevention for the exact validated rig. Normal operation still requests the meridian flip near +2 degrees and stops around +5 degrees while the host application is alive.
